When the scalp environment loses stability, in either the pH condition or the hygiene conditions are compromised, dandruff thrives. Using apple cider vinegar mixed with a predetermined proportion of water can help restore a healthy pH level and reduce flaking eliminating dandruff.
A warm and gentle massage using natural oils suitable to climatic conditions, like coconut, gingelly, castor or olive oil can uproot dead skin cells from the scalp and soothe the dry and itchy scalp, giving complete nourishment to the hair and remove dandruff.
Tea tree oil is a natural extract with antifungal properties that combat the thriving Malassezia yeast and acts like a culture agent for dandruff. Dilute a few drops of this essential oil with a carrier oil like almond or coconut oil and warm the mixture before applying it to your scalp.
Baking soda is a household item, in everybody’s kitchen. Did you know it is a natural exfoliant that helps remove the factor which causes dandruff and absorbs excess oil? Gently massage your scalp with a mixture of baking soda and water into your scalp before shampooing.
Aloe vera’s soothing of inflamed areas can help calm an irritated scalp and reduce itching caused by dandruff. Applying fresh aloe vera gel without the toxic yellow liquid, directly to the scalp and leaving it on for 30 minutes before rinsing, will eradicate dandruff significantly.
As yogurt is rich in lactic acid, lentil powder which acts as an exfoliant and lemon juice has anti-fungal properties, these three ingredients found in your kitchen act as a natural hair scrub. It can be mixed and applied as a pack for your hair half an hour before shampooing. Continuing to use this for a few months will completely remove dandruff
